Running a dedicated server in my PC (Gigabyte G5 KC [RTX 3060 laptop])

I haven't been able to connect to the server, always get the same "couldn't retrieve server information message"
The server doesn't even appear on the servers list, I already checked the firewall, router ports, antivirus, fully reinstalled both the game and the server (I'm running the steam version BTW) but nothing seems to work so far.

 

My server log:  https://pastebin.com/DRh2SUaD


I'm very noob at this so all suggestions will be appreciated.

These is the port forwarding mess I did and I'm sure is completely wrong so if anyone can help me with that I would appreciate it a lot as well.

Your port forwarding is set up incorrectly. Your private ports are correct (26900 through to 26902 on TCP and UDP) but the public ports are 1521 and 69 which means your port forwarder is listening on the wrong ports and ignoring the right ones.

 

Set the public ports to be the same and it should work.

 

You really shouldn't forward 8080 and 8081 unless you need to and have a strong password on your server. That lets people remote access into the management console. 8082 is no longer in use and you don't need to forward it.

Game ports should be 26900 TCP and 26900-26903 UDP.

Quick update, I think I managed to do it, I had to watch like 20 videos about my router but I managed to open the right ports this timespacer.png

 

After that I attempted to join the server and it let me through right away, no more "could not retrieve server information" message, I'll have a few friends attempt to join in order to confirm that it worked, but so far it seems like the ports were the main reason for the inconvenience.
